Re: [Apple iPod] Shuffle, is it really?

I have the same complaint about the shuffle.
With over 8000 songs it seems I often hear the same song played and I have
realized that when you reboot your iPod or sync it then the shuffle will
start all over again so that tells me that there is no intelligence within
the iPod to keep track of the songs played and base that against the
shuffle.
In iTunes there is a option in preferences under the playback tab that lets
you set the ability of hearing the same artists or album but I tend to
believe it only applies if your playing music via iTunes and not the iPod.
